This post compares Ontario, California to San Bernardino,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Ontario (city) San Bernardino (city)
Population 171,041 215,252
Income (median) $37,139 $33,949
Home Value (median) $320,000 $202,100
White 47% 57%
Black 5% 14%
Asian 5% 4%
With Kids 45% 47%
Age (median) 32 29
Rentals 46% 53%
